Buying Guide

Check omega‑3 form

Krill oil typically supplies omega‑3s bound to phospholipids, which can affect absorption compared with triglyceride fish oils

Look for EPA and DHA detail

Compare labels for explicit EPA and DHA milligram amounts or total omega‑3 per serving rather than capsule weight alone

Consider added antioxidants

Astaxanthin is commonly included in krill oil to protect lipids and provide antioxidant benefits, so check its presence if that matters to you

Evaluate dose per softgel

Higher milligram per softgel formulations can reduce daily capsule count, important for convenience and adherence

Assess value score not just price

Compare cost per effective omega‑3 dose and formulation features to judge value rather than choosing solely by cost
